John Henry Rich, Jr., age 64, of Sweet Springs, Missouri passed away on Friday, December 30, 2022, at his home surrounded by the love of his family.
John was born on July 16, 1958, to the late John Henry and Vernell (Coffee) Rich, Sr.
He graduated from Sweet Springs High School, Class of 1976, where he played football and in the summer was on the summer league softball team. He was united in marriage on October 19, 1977, to Jacqueline Diane Artis, and to this union they were blessed with one son, Marcus.
John was an avid KC Chiefs and KC Royals fan, and went to the first opening Royals game every year. He loved antique car shows, sprint cars, custom cars, and went to many car shows to watch his nephew win a number of competitions. No matter the task, he was a hard worker who devoted ten years to Wilson Foods, and thirty years to Tyson Deli Foods in Concordia, Missouri. Everyone who knew John and Jacqueline knew they had better never call between 6:30 and 7:00 p.m. while they were watching Wheel of Fortune, their favorite show!
He accepted the Lord as his Savior at a young age and attended the Malta Bend Yokum Chapel A.M.E. Church under the leadership of Pastor Dolly Crutchfield until he married. After his marriage, he joined the Fairview Missionary Baptist Church, and lastly attended the Macedonia Church of God in Christ in Marshall, Missouri.
John is survived by his wife Jacqueline, of the home; his son, Marcus Rich and wife Kerri, of Sweet Springs, Missouri; two grandchildren, Jaheem Rich of St. Louis, Missouri, and Da'-Marcus Rich of Sweet Springs, Missouri; siblings, George Rich, Sr., and wife Diane, of Sweet Springs, Missouri, Lonnie Rich, Sr., of Jefferson City, Missouri, Anna Kemp and husband Oscar, of Columbia, Missouri; brothers-in-law, Matthew Artis and wife Angie of DeWitt, Missouri, and Christopher Artis and wife Mildred, of DeWitt, Missouri; sisters-in-law, Loretta Rich of Marshall, Missouri, and Rona Lewis of Jefferson City, Missouri; a host of nieces, nephews; family, and friends; and one Goddaughter, Tanijia Lewis of Columbia, Missouri, who happened to share the same birthday. Each year they would get together and celebrate.
John was preceded in death by his parents; one sister, Mary Scott; two nephews, Sedrick Lewis, and Christopher Porter; and two nieces, Jody Lee and Lakedria Kemp; and his father-in-law and mother-in-law, Matthew and Sarah Artis.
